Fees 2008

Tuition Fees 2008

Preschool$47 per day
Junior School (Kindergarten - Year 5)$3,780 per annum
($945 per term)
Middle School (Years 6 - Year 8) $4,540 per annum
($1,135 per term)
Senior School (Years 9-12)

$5,380 per annum

($1,345 per term)


Tuition fees are charged each term (there are four terms in the year) and include general classroom requirements, eg workbooks, exercise books etc. 

Extra Charges

Excursions, camps, swimming lessons, performances, private music tuition, calculators, dictionaries, Middle School Sport, team sports, Mathletics, cocurricular activities etc are charged in addition to the tuition charge.

Design and Technology – Year 7-8 students will be charged a subject levy of $12 per term; Years 9-10 students will be charged a subject levy of $30 per term; and Year 11-12 students will be charged a subject levy of $30 per term plus the cost of any materials that they use.

Art – Year 9-10 students will be charged a subject levy of $25 per term; Year 11-12 students will be charged a subject levy of $30 per term.

Fashion and Design - Senior School students undertaking the Fashion and Design elective will be required to purchase their own equipment and materials.

Sibling Discounts

Second and subsequent children attending the school concurrently will receive a sibling discount as follows:

            Second child                                                     5%

            Third child                                                         20%

            Fourth child                                                       30%

            Fifth and subsequent children                              45%

The sibling discount is applied in descending academic order and does not apply to children in the Preschool.

Methods of payment

School fees may be paid by BPay (from a cheque, savings or credit account) or by cheque or cash.  The school also offers direct debit (from a cheque or savings account).  Monthly direct debit payments are made on the 15th of each month in ten instalments from February to November.  Fortnightly direct debit payments are made across 24 fortnights from January to early December.  Further information can be obtained from the Accounts Office (upstairs in the Central Resources Building). 

Due Date

School fees are due and payable by the end of the second week of each term unless arrangements have been made for direct debit payments. Families experiencing temporary difficulties should contact the Head of Business before the due date to discuss payment options.  Fees not paid by the due date will otherwise attract an overdue fee charge. If a fee account remains unpaid after the third week of term the school reserves the right to ask a family to make arrangements for their child/ren’s education elsewhere.

Notice of Withdrawal

One term’s written notice of withdrawal must be provided to the school or one term’s fees plus GST is payable in lieu of notice.
